Overview
Twin Central - intuitive industrial digital twin builder that provides semantic asset modeling, mapping and management from operational, engineering and transactional metadata sources. A simple approach to create and manage an asset-centric, single source of truth and semantic data model across the enterprise. Twin Central can create digital twin data models that map, connect, link, store, and synchronize relationships.
Highlights
- Semantic enterprise asset data modelling
- Connect operational, engineering and transactional metadata sources.
- Combine asset meta data, models and hierarchies from historians/SCADA and business systems

Delivery details
64-bit (x86) Amazon Machine Image (AMI)
Amazon Machine Image (AMI)
An AMI is a virtual image that provides the information required to launch an instance. Amazon EC2 (Elastic Compute Cloud) instances are virtual servers on which you can run your applications and workloads, offering varying combinations of CPU, memory, storage, and networking resources. You can launch as many instances from as many different AMIs as you need.

Usage instructions
Usage instruction:
- Launch the EC2 from AMI
- Login via RDP Port 3389 via TPC using the AWS provided credentials (via EC connect) Please follow these steps to get your new Twin Central system configured and up and running quickly.
- Click on the "Read Me First" con and read the instructions
- Accordingly configure according to your network and architecture
- Connect to your systems and applications (steps in "Read Me First")
